I tried installing Ubuntu, Kubuntu, and Mandriva, and I could get none of them to install. Ubuntu and Kubuntu load up the bootscreen (which is extremely dark btw) and after it loads the bootscreen it just shows 3 logos across the screen with the rest of the screen black, and it freezes (or maybe there's something I have to click but I can't see it because it was absorbed by the darkness [Earthbound reference ftw]) while Mandriva's colors are just fine, but freezes at a black screen after the boot screen and some status screens.

Is it possibly a driver problem? My video card is by Visiontek and it's an ATI Radeon 2600 HD Pro AGP and I have SoundMAX for my sound card, and using a Pentium IV with 1.8 ghz cpu and over 600 mb of ram, and it's made by Dell.

taurus
May 22nd, 2009, 12:55 AM
At the Ubuntu initial screen, press F4 for safe graphics mode. See if that works.
